Standard block manufacturing produces square shapes.
We use Wire EDM (Electrical Discharge Machining) or Profile Grinding.
These techniques produce triangular geometries with strict symmetry and zero tooling costs for custom sizes.

The “Tip” Challenge

This explains why your product (with rounded corners) is better than a cheap sharp triangle.

1. Tip Fragility & Safety:
Sintered Neodymium is brittle.
A triangle with razor-sharp vertices (<60โˆ˜) is extremely prone to structural failure.

The Risk:
– The sharp tips will chip instantly upon impact (the “corner snap” effect).

Our Solution:
– We apply a controlled Corner Radius (R) to all three tips (as seen in the photo).

The Benefit:
– This dramatically increases durability.
– Prevents the magnet from scratching surfaces.
– And ensures a smooth, uniform plating layer without “burnt” or rough edges.

2. Mosaic & Modular Fit:

The Application:
– Triangles are often used to form larger polygons (hexagons) or linear arrays.

The Fit:
– Our Wire EDM process ensures that the side walls are perfectly straight and perpendicular.
– This allows multiple triangles to be tiled together with minimal gaps.

Magnetization Orientation

Axial (Through Thickness): The standard orientation.

– Configuration: The triangular face is North, the opposite face is South.
– Use: Stacking, holding, or sticking to a steel wall.

Linear Halbach Array:

– Configuration: The magnetization vector is parallel to one of the sides.
– Use: Specialized motor or particle physics applications.

Surface Coatings

Nickel (Ni-Cu-Ni):
– As shown.
– The rounded corners allow the Nickel to flow smoothly around the tips.
– This creates a continuous corrosion barrier.

Gold (Au):
– Popular for triangular magnets used in jewelry or executive desk toys.

Epoxy:
– For industrial sensors.

Applications

Modular Connectors: Self-aligning magnetic connectors that only lock in 3 specific orientations.
Sensor Housings: Fitting a magnet into a V-shaped groove or corner.
Art & Design: Magnetic puzzles, tangrams, and tessellating wall art.
Textile Fasteners: Triangular shapes resist rotation better than circles when sewn into fabric pockets.
